Edquity is an anti-poverty technology company that helps colleges improve students’ basic needs and financial security by increasing access to emergency resources and funding. To help students, including the 3 million who drop out every year due to a time sensitive financial crisis, Edquity provides partner colleges with a mobile app and web platform that helps students overcome financial emergencies. With Edquity, students can apply for emergency cash grants, discover emergency resources, receive personalized financial management, and more.

In the wake of COVID-19, students need Edquity more than ever, and Edquity is quickly scaling to ensure it can support millions of students during this crisis.

Edquity has raised over $6.5MM in funding from some of the leading impact and postsecondary success investors and has also received support from foundations like the Bill and Melinda Gates Foundation.
